Replacing the SAAB 9-3 key fob

It's a good idea find a spare key for Saab 9-3 vehicles which only have one key. A new key is not cheap, but it's far less expensive than replacing the entire vehicle. To add a new key, it is necessary to use a specialized tool known as the Tech2. The car will also require an entirely new CIM module as well as a brand new ignition key. The only key that can be programmed to the car is the new one. It is not able to be used on another vehicle.

To replace the Saab 9-3 key in the car, the owner will need to call the dealer's service department and set up an appointment. The technician will require the unique code for the new key. They may also need to replace the CIM or the TWICE module. Dealers will need to reprogram the ignition cylinders in order to accept the new keys.

The process of replacing the battery in the Saab 9-3 key fob is a simple process. First remove the emergency key from the fob using a flathead screwdriver. The screwdriver should be inserted into the slot located in the middle of your Fob, and gently move it around. After a while the case will split open, and you can easily access the battery. Avoid pouring liquids on the Fob since this can damage the electronic components.
